Ham bone shaped dog treat
Description
FIG. 1 is a top plan view of a ham bone shaped dog treat showing my new design, the bottom plan view being a mirror image; and,
FIG. 2 is a side perspective view of FIG. 1, the opposite side being substantially the same, the only differences being the dimensions and contours of the simulated meat and fat, which follow the dimensions and contours thereof shown in FIG. 1.
Claims
The ornamental design for a ham bone shaped dog treat, as shown and described.
